425th Assault Regiment Placed Under Operational Command of 1st Azov Corps

The 425th Assault Regiment “Skelya” has been placed under the operational command of the National Guard’s 1st Azov Corps, the regiment’s head of communications, Oleksiy Bratuschak, said in an interview with ButusovPlus.
“Currently, we are carrying out combat orders under the operational command of the Azov Corps. Not all units have been transferred yet, but we understand that the process is underway to unite all our scattered battalions and separate detachments so that they can carry out missions on a single section of the front,” Bratuschak said.
According to Bratuschak, the regiment will not become part of the Azov structure but will instead be under the corps’ operational command. The 425th Regiment is not being incorporated into the National Guard; rather, it has been temporarily placed under the command of the 1st Azov Corps.
He also said the decision was made by the newly appointed Commander-in-Chief, Mykhailo Drapatyi, and that the regiment views the move positively.
The 425th Regiment will operate in the Dobropillya direction, where the Azov Corps is currently deployed.
Previously, the regiment operated in the area of responsibility of the 7th Air Assault Corps while remaining subordinate to the Operational Task Force East.
